Transaction d79e0e90fc7733e21a1424f8223a5ce6c8ff94a7056c812851c5bef33e861d57
1 Input
2 Outputs
- d79e0e90fc7733e21a1424f8223a5ce6c8ff94a7056c812851c5bef33e861d57:0
- d79e0e90fc7733e21a1424f8223a5ce6c8ff94a7056c812851c5bef33e861d57:1
value 1385266
address 3CzUKhVRYS7vk2w5L9vv3wX5LvFKtYHvxn
value 362781
address 3EmbEvpTVC1YbwHyjZEg4XXRth7c6uG9JP